// show the difference between calling a short js function // relative to a comparable C++ function. // Reports n of calls per second. // Note that JS speed goes up, while cxx speed stays about the same. 'use strict'; const assert = require('assert'); const common = require('../../common.js'); // this fails when we try to open with a different version of node, // which is quite common for benchmarks. so in that case, just // abort quietly. try { var binding = require('./build/Release/binding'); } catch { console.error('misc/function_call.js Binding failed to load'); process.exit(0); } const cxx = binding.hello; let napi_binding; try { napi_binding = require('./build/Release/napi_binding'); } catch { console.error('misc/function_call/index.js NAPI-Binding failed to load'); process.exit(0); } const napi = napi_binding.hello; var c = 0; function js() { return c++; } assert(js() === cxx()); const bench = common.createBenchmark(main, { type: ['js', 'cxx', 'napi'], n: [1e6, 1e7, 5e7] }); function main({ n, type }) { const fn = type === 'cxx' ? cxx : type === 'napi' ? napi : js; bench.start(); for (var i = 0; i < n; i++) { fn(); } bench.end(n); }
